Substantiv

  1. 1

    The act of pronouncing a judicial sentence on someone convicted of a crime.

    After the verdict, the sentencing was not delayed.

    Following the sentencing, Knutton said: "What sort of person does something so cold and calculating? I did not expect her to go to jail for it. I am just glad it is now all over."

  2. 2

    That which has been pronounced as a judgement or sentence for a crime.

  3. 3

    The act of creating one or more complete sentences from fragmented thoughts and phrases.

    He struggled with sentencing his frayed and angry verses from poem to prose.
